GHS: Update the link line processing

-- add missing executable linker libs from:
   CMAKE_C_STANDARD_LIBRARIES
-- add missed transitive link libraries
-- add skipped library linker options
-- The linker expects -l../relative/path/to/lib.a to be relative to the top-level project
   Because there can be multiple top-level projects convert the path to an absolute path to target
